Re: HP for NFCU membership?

 

One hard pull for joining to establish initial account.

 

Additional hard pull for each credit product, CCs, NavChek, auto, etc...

 

No pull to open an checking account if you're already a member.

Re: HP for NFCU membership?

To OP
NFCU HP TU for me upon joining. I opened a savings & checking in February. One month later I app'd for NavCheck. A few weeks ago I received an invitation by mail to app the Cash Rewards. Both, NavCheck & cc app was HP on EQ.
If you are rebuilding, I say go for it, it's worth it. I was hesitant to app the Cash Rewards due to recent card approvals, four in the past months. @Creditaddict gave me the push to app, & I'm glad for it.
DH was recently approved for a Cash Rewards ($5,000) with EQ of 595. His utility was 10% at the time he app'd. GL!
